Ingredients:
- 4 large russet potatoes, scrubbed clean
- 4 tablespoons olive oil
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- 1 ½ cups shredded cheddar cheese
- 6 slices bacon, cooked and crumbled
- ½ cup sour cream
- 2 tablespoons chopped chives (for garnish)
Instructions:
-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Prick the potatoes several times with a fork and rub them with 2 tablespoons of olive oil. Place the potatoes on a baking sheet and bake for 45–50 minutes, or until tender when pierced with a fork. Allow them to cool slightly.
- Once cool enough to handle, slice each potato in half lengthwise. Scoop out the insides, leaving about ¼ inch of potato flesh around the edges.
- Brush the inside and outside of the potato skins with the remaining olive oil, then season with salt and pepper.
- Place the potato halves cut-side down on the baking sheet and bake for 10 minutes. Flip them over and bake for another 10 minutes until the skins are crispy.
- Remove the potato skins from the oven and sprinkle them with shredded cheddar cheese and crumbled bacon. Return to the oven and bake for an additional 5–7 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
- Remove from the oven and top each potato skin with a dollop of sour cream and a sprinkle of chopped chives.
